ANTIFERROMAGNETISM OF THE Fe-Ni ALLOYS IN THE INVAR COMPOSITION

Y. Tino

Faculty of Science, Science University of Tokyo, Kagurazaka 1-3, Shinjuku-ku, Tokyo, Japan


Abstract
Antiferromagnetism of the Fe-Ni Invar alloys was studied mainly by Mössbauer spectroscopy. It is seen that various hyperfine fields are superposed there, and that the superposition becomes larger with increasing cold-working. This causes amorphous-like structures, which leads to various incomplete antiferromagnetism coming from the magnetic forces, originating the Invar anomaly.
